Rattled by the protests outside the Pakistan High Commission in New Delhi,a worried Islamabad Wednesday asked Delhi to ensure safety and security of Pakistans diplomats,and to beef up the protection of Pakistan envoy Salman Bashir.
It is learnt that Pakistan Foreign Ministrys Director General (South Asia) Rifat Masood called in Indian Deputy High Commissioner Gopal Baglay Wednesday and expressed concern at the protests outside the Pakistan High Commission premises. The police had to use water cannons to disperse the protesters,who were agitating against Tuesdays killing of five soldiers at the Line of Control (LoC).
The Pakistan High Commission decided to close the mission for the next four days from August 8 to 11 essentially advancing its Eid holidays,after careful consideration,sources said.
Security outside the Pakistan High Commissioners residence at Tilak Marg has been beefed up,sources said.
Amid outrage over the LoC killings,Pakistan Foreign Secretary Jalil Abbas Jilani sent a congratulatory message to Foreign Secretary Sujatha Singh and appreciated her desire to pick up the threads of the bilateral dialogue process from where it was left off.
